> That should be correct.
> 
> What printer? What platform?
> 
> If it's a 1280, you may find that the standard 1280 curves lead to
> flat/muddy midtones around 70% (many of us have had this problem 
with the
> recent VM inksets) - if you do, try the Tyler Boley  curves and/or 
Pauls
> 1290 curves, both of them give me _way_ better results.
> 
> You could also try Roy's QuadtoneRIP which has some really nice 
curve
> development tools included (and it's free! :) )

> > I am still worried that my new Ultratone inks may be wrongly
> > labelled due to the issues I am having with the curves.  I have
> > triple checked my installation - it is OK and the ink order is :
> > K - black
> > C - Dark grey
> > M - Dark blue toner
> > Y - light grey
> > PC - Mid grey
> > PM - light blue toner.
> >
> > IS this correct?  I couldn't find info on the positions anywhere, 
a
> > short reply would be a great help.
